LONDON UK/ SPOKANE WA – Magnuson Hotels announced the complete rebranding of the Magnuson Hotel Cool Springs.

Formerly franchised by Wyndham Hotels as the Wingate by Wyndham in Brentwood, Tennessee, the hotel will upgrade its local, regional and national market to attract business, group and leisure travelers via an affiliation with Magnuson Hotels’ global portfolio of nearly 2,000 hotels.

Corporate, educational, government and leisure travelers will appreciate this 106-room facility located just 6 miles from downtown Brentwood and 16 miles from Nashville. Guests will appreciate close proximity to the Cool Springs Galleria, Nashville Zoo, and the Grand Ole Opry.

The Magnuson Hotel Cool Springs offers free continental breakfast, exercise room, outdoor pool, business center and free parking. All guest rooms feature free wireless internet, microwave, mini-fridge, hair dryer, free local calls, alarm clock/radio, cable TV, iron and board, and electronic door locks.

“We are proud to welcome John Cajka and his entire staff, and are fully committed to increasing their property visibility and reservations,” stated Thomas Magnuson, CEO of Magnuson Worldwide.

As a Magnuson Hotels affiliate, the Magnuson Hotel Cool Springs is a member of the Magnuson Hotels Premier Collection, an elite portfolio of the highest quality hotels and locations represented by Magnuson Worldwide.

The Magnuson Hotel Cool Springs will receive complete global brand representation without the costs and requirements of franchise brand affiliation. It will expand its business through Magnuson Hotels’ massive hotel reservation network including 650,000 GDS travel agents, all global corporate accounts, over 2,000 internet booking channels such as Global Hotel Exchange, Expedia, Hotels.com, Priceline, and all major airlines websites.
